  • Patent number: 6635474
    Abstract: There are disclosed mammary gland tissue-specific expression systems using the promoter site for the &bgr;-casein gene of Korean native goats, by use of which physiological activating substances can be produced. In each of the expression systems, that is, novel plasmids pGbc, pGbc_L and pGbc_S (deposition Nos. KCTC 0515BP, 0514BP and 0513BP, respectively), a &bgr;-casein gene expression-regulating region, a physiological activating substance gene and a termination-regulating region are linked. Human granulocyte colony stimulating factor (hG-CSF) or human granulocyte macrophage colony stimulating factor (hGM-CSF) can be produced in HC11 cells, a mouse mammary gland tissue-derived cell line, and in the milk secreted from the transgenic mice by use of a hG-CSF or hGM-CSF gene-carrying pGbc, pGbc_L or pGbc_S in transfection into cell and microinjection to mouse. The proteins are those which experience the posttranslational modification and maintain their normal activity in the human body.

  • Publication number: 20030051257
    Abstract: A transgenic goat zygote is developed from a goat zygote comprising a nucleic acid construct containing a nucleotide sequence of a goat &bgr;-casein promoter and a nucleotide sequence encoding hG-CSF, which produces milk containing a high concentration of biologically active hG-CSF.

  • Publication number: 20020104000
    Abstract: A method for distributively managing the CRL in a certifying system to certify the validity of a subscriber in an open communications network such as Internet, includes the steps of registering the certificate policy statement for the CRL by determining the distribution interval of the CRL; setting the structure of the certificate of the subscriber to issue the certificate according to the registered certificate policy statement; attesting the certificate by applying the distribution point mechanism according to the distribution interval to the CRL; and revoking the certificate by using the distribution points to revise the CRL displayed.

  • Publication number: 20010054111
    Abstract: A system and method for providing information services using a bar code at a wireless terminal, which is capable of receiving a variety of information services including user authentication through a network by receiving a bar code from a wireless terminal over the Internet and reading the transmitted bar code from a bar code system of a member store. The bar code system is constructed such that various services may be offered through a bar code system associated with a bar code issue server using a bar code transmitted to the wireless terminal through the Internet. Accordingly, the information service system and method are provided for various on line business services while not substantially modifying conventional bar code systems. Also, a bar code service can be offered through the wireless terminal, thereby allowing for excellent mobility compared with the conventional bar code system.

  • Publication number: 20010054006
    Abstract: A points trading service method is provided and includes the steps of (a) collecting information on a customers' trading points total from a member shop and storing the information in a customer database; (b) receiving information on a points trade request from a customer; and (c) trading points with other customers according to the points trade request. According to the method of the present invention, a customer can redeem a small amount of points into cash and exchange the points the user does not want to use for other points. Upon collecting trading points, a customer can also use the cyber money or points at a plurality of member shops. Therefore, when the method according to the present invention is applied, Internet business marketing and cyber money use can be extended and promoted.
